  Demonstrated Reading

Demonstrated Reading is the daily sharing of a high quality, engaging text over a five-day time frame. Each day, the teacher (and the students, with gradually increasing experience and control of the text) reads aloud the same text, modeling fluency, expression, rhythm, rhyme, and the appropriate syntax of narrative stories and poetry. The teacher models a specific reading skill or strategy each day, including phonemic awareness, phonics skills, new vocabulary, and comprehension strategies.
